Purpose/Material Description.
This specification defines grease formulated with polyalkylene glycol (PAG) oil and lithium soap thickener having zero (0) consistency to three (3) consistency.

Applicability.
Due to its compatibility with ethylene propylene diene monomer (EPDM) elastomers; compatibility with brake fluids Department of Transportation (DOT) 3, DOT 4 and DOT 5.1; efficient wear protection; good adhesion; and water resistance, this grease can be used in vehicle brake and clutch systems.
Remarks.
Many formulations of the same type of elastomer and plastic can be found. Therefore, compatibility of the specific elastomer or plastic with grease must be verified. ASTM D4289, the standard test method for elastomer compatibility of lubricating greases and fluids, can be used to evaluate compatibility of grease with elastomers. The limit for volume change and durometer A hardness should meet the materials and subsystems requirements. The compatibility requirements of other non-metallic materials should be established in consultation with material engineers. This specification does not include extreme pressure performance requirements. A wear test should be conducted before using this grease on aluminum or aluminum alloys under dynamically high load conditions. Aluminum typically has a natural or artificially increased (anodized) aluminumoxide surface layer that is resistant to PAG. High loads can remove this layer allowing PAG to attack the exposed aluminum metal and cause fretting corrosion.
